### Troubleshooting: DispatchWeave assignment stalls

Symptom: drivers show as eligible but no assignment fires. Check heuristic queue depth first; anything over 500 means the scorer is backlogged. Restart the scorer pod only after draining. If assignments still stall, pull the last 100 decisions from the audit endpoint and check for scoring weights set to zero. Audit queries against the Fenmoor staging stack require the bearer token below.

login token, bagug-kafop: eyJhbGciOiJIUzI1NiIsInR5cCI6IkpXVCJ9.eyJzdWIiOiIcMLov2In0.Z5RLDIfp

Driftpane's large-file diff viewer now chunks files above 2 MB instead of rendering them whole, and syntax highlighting is disabled by default past that threshold. Plugin authors relying on full-document token streams must opt into the legacy mode explicitly; the hook signature is unchanged, but chunked documents arrive incrementally. Inline annotations anchored by byte offset continue to work; line-based anchors may shift across chunk boundaries. The new default configuration shipped with 4.2 is listed here.

settings of yageg-yahap:
[gorael]
team = olieth
access_code = ac_941d74
owner = brieth.aldiel
host = gorael.tolvaqio.internal
port = 6379
peer = briwyn.urlaqtech.internal
salt = 116e6622
pin = 1957

Handover Note — Warranty-Cost Overrun, Ostrell Division

To my successor and the heads of department: warranty costs on the Ostrell R-Series ran 27% over budget this year, traced to a heat-cycling fault in the control module. I've documented the supplier negotiations, the revised testing protocol, and the accrual adjustments in the shared planning folder. The recall reserve is adequate through Q2, but review it monthly. Quality has committed to a redesigned module by spring. The business plan this overrun affects is noted confidentially below.

board note of tadup-tajog: Headcount on the Oliiel team goes from 31 to 88 by the end of February. Gross margin on Oliiel came in at 62 percent against a plan of 29 percent.